LONG ISLAND, N.Y. – All 18 members of the Kutztown University women's bowling team bowled singles in the Adelphi Invitational Saturday, which benefited the Lupus Foundation.
The Golden Bears were led by
Christine Gordon (Cherry Hill, N.J./Cherry Hill East) who finished third out of a total of 72 NCAA players who competed on the day.
Lauren Stamm (Reading, Pa./Governor Mifflin), and
Deanna DiRado (Greensburg, PA/Greensburg Salem) also represented the Maroon and Gold in the top 16 on the day.
Gordon won the first round match against Jackie Carbonetto of Sacred Heart (208-136).
Stamm defeated DiRado (179-136), and Gordon defeated Stamm in the next round (185-125).
Brittany Heart of LIU - Brooklyn defeated Gordon (207-186), but Gordon went on to defeat Ashley Howe of St. Francis (Pa.) (192-158) in the third place match.
The Golden Bears continue competition tomorrow for the team portion of the Adelphi Invitational featuring all quad baker matches.
